Recognizes a PFA member group chapter that has dedicated personal financial support for the betterment of that chapter's community.
This Chapter participates in a wide range of events from feeding the homeless to many walks within the community. The major event for the Chapter each year was created by one Brother in honor of her aunt that had ovarian cancer. It is called the T.E.A.L. (Tell Every Amazing Lady about ovarian cancer) This event has grown tremendously over just 2 years. It is one of only 6 cities in the country that have started this event. The first T.E.AL. walk in 2014 had 59 participants and raised $1800 for ovarian cancer research. The second annual T.EA.L. walk in 2015 had 179 participants and raised $11,000. The event for this year is set for September 24, 2016 and their fundraising goal is $12,000. This event is growing exponentially to reach many women in the low country area and educate them on ovarian cancer.
